The University of Tbingen is one of Germanys top-level research universities, with a broad spectrum of subjects based on long tradition. With its ambitious institutional strategy the University has been successful in the governments Excellence Initiative. In order to support young researchers in achieving independence at an early stage of their scientific careers, the university offers
One position for a Junior Research Group Leader in Social & Cultural Anthropology
for a young scientist with a highly promising track record. Candidates with an excellent doctorate and postdoctoral experience of two to four years will be enabled to lead a cutting-edge project in close collaboration with the newly established Collaborative Research Center (SFB) 1070 on ResourceCultures. The candidate is expected to contribute to the further development of theoretical concepts linking the disciplines involved in the SFB. The university is particularly interested in research which explores new avenues in the cooperation between anthropology and archaeology/historical sciences. The project should involve one PhD student from archaeology/historical sciences who will be supervised and guided by the JRG leader. The University of Tbingen actively seeks to foster career opportunities for female researchers and therefore strongly encourages qualified women to apply.
